Syria rejects the draft resolution submitted to the United Nations General Assembly on Ukraine

New York, (ST) – Syria affirmed its rejection of the draft resolution submitted to the United Nations General Assembly on Ukraine.

Syria’s Permanent Representative to the United Nations, Ambassador Bassam Sabbagh said in a speech during an extraordinary session on Ukraine that, the draft resolution before us today expresses a biased approach based on political propaganda and represents a tool of pressure and political blackmail.

 He added that, this draft resolution includes hostile language against the Russian Federation aimed at undermining Russian Federation’s position and its legitimate right to protect its land and people.

Ambassador Sabbagh said that, the draft resolution represents outright political hypocrisy, because if the United States of America and its Western allies were really serious about defusing tension in that region, they would have fulfilled the promises they made to the Russian Federation three decades ago not to expand NATO to the east and not to turn Ukraine into a source of direct and real threat to the Russian Federation.

Sabbagh also added that, ” if the United States of America and its Western allies were really serious about defusing tension in that region, they would have pressured the Kyiv authorities to abide by the Minsk agreements and stop their grave violations against civilians in Donbass.”

Ambassador Sabbagh went on to say that, those who are enthusiastic today about defending the Charter of the United Nations had to show the same enthusiasm against Israel’s continued occupation of Arab lands and against the Turkish forces’ violation of the sovereignty of Syrian lands, and the violation of Syrian sovereignty by the United States of America forces.

Ambassador Sabbagh said that, the authors of the draft resolution were keen to include hostile language directed against the Russian Federation aimed at undermining its position and its legitimate right to protect its land and people from the real threat to its national security.

Ambassador Sabbagh pointed out that, the presentation of the draft resolution today is accompanied by massive misleading media and major campaigns to distort facts and spread false information. “It was not designed to search for a real solution to the crisis, but rather to demonize the Russian Federation and distort its image, indicating that it is a text full of gaps and far from objectivity and ignores the real reasons behind igniting Fuse this crisis”, he added.

Ambassador Sabbagh reiterated the Syrian Arab Republic’s rejection of the West’s policy of hegemony and interference in the internal affairs of member states, igniting and prolonging crises, spreading chaos, consolidating selectivity and double standards and imposing coercive unilateral measures, which necessitates rejecting and voting against this draft resolution.
